'Tum saath ho' takes you back to the Rahman of Rangeela, specially thanks to the levelled vocals of 1990s regular Alka Yagnik, accompanied by a confident Arijit Singh. 'Wat wat wat' finds Arijit in a different, upbeat mood. The dance song has addictive beats and Punjabi vocals by Shashwat Singh. 'Chali kahani' is a narrative in the voice of Sukhwinder Singh whose voice rises to a crescendo. Haricharan and Haripriya lend able support. Road song 'Safarnama' marks a comeback of sorts for Lucky Ali who sounds a lot like Rahman here.
